"The Skull Man" is a dark, mystery-driven anime series set in a fictional Japanese city called Otomo, where societal unrest and political corruption create a tense atmosphere. The story revolves around Hayato Mikogami, a photojournalist who returns to his hometown to investigate a series of gruesome murders linked to a mysterious figure known as the Skull Man. This enigmatic vigilante, clad in a skull mask, is rumored to be responsible for the killings, targeting individuals connected to a powerful conglomerate called the Otomo Group.

As Hayato delves deeper into the case, he uncovers a web of conspiracies involving secret experiments, genetic manipulation, and the resurgence of an ancient cult. The Skull Man's actions are tied to a broader conflict between the cult, which seeks to revive a mythical being called the "Black Pharaoh," and the Otomo Group, which aims to exploit supernatural forces for its own gain. Hayato's investigation intersects with the lives of several key figures, including Kiriko Mamiya, a determined reporter, and Tatsuo Kagura, a detective with a personal vendetta against the Skull Man.

The narrative explores themes of revenge, identity, and the blurred line between justice and vengeance. The Skull Man's true identity is gradually revealed, tying him to Hayato's own past and the tragic events that shaped his life. The series builds toward a climactic confrontation as the cult's plans come to fruition, threatening to unleash chaos upon the city. Through its intricate plot and morally ambiguous characters, "The Skull Man" presents a gripping tale of mystery and supernatural intrigue, grounded in a world where human ambition and ancient forces collide.
